We Care
BlackBerry Smartphones: Mobilizing the
Delivery of Home Care Services -
Case Study - new
Customer Profile
We Care Home Health Services is
a large independently owned home care services
provider in Canada, with more than 50 community
locations and 5,000 staff.
Solution
Working with MedShare, We Care deployed the MedShare for BlackBerry application on several BlackBerry®
smartphones. The application helped to confirm care
workers’ shifts, keep track of client information and
almost instantly send completed timesheets into the
company’s Procura back-end billing and payroll system. |

Common Intake Assessment Tool.
Case Study
Customer Profile
The Continuing Care e-Health Council is a division of the Ontario Ministry of Health that works closely with the Ontario e-Health Secretariat to enhance patient and client care by delivering more efficient tools for health care providers.
Business Situation
The Continuing Care e-Health Council began to review strategies and technology solutions that would minimize the administrative burden of Ontario's current home care Intake Assessment process and allow for greater standardization. Thus, the solution is to shift the focus of the current system from paper-work to care-work.
Solution
MedShare developed the Common Intake Assessment Tool (CIAT), standardizing the definitions and processes in capturing client information in order to allow sharing of information across the province. |
